Tyler Rogers earns the win on Tuesday

by Jon Mathisen | Giants Correspondent | Wed, Jul 28th 1:44am EDT

RHP Tyler Rogers got the win on Tuesday when he worked a scoreless inning of relief, allowing two hits and punching out one in the Giants' 2-1 win over the Dodgers.

Fantasy Impact:

Rogers worked the eighth inning with the score tied up at 1-1 and quickly ran into some trouble by allowing a single and a double with a strikeout wedged in the middle. He was able to work his way out of it and ended up earning the win as the Giants took the lead in the bottom half of the frame. It was Roger' second win of the season and he now owns a sparkling 1.91 ERA, 1.04 WHIP, and 27:9 K/B ratio over 47 innings. He's been a valuable asset in NSH leagues, recording 17 holds and 11 saves this year.
